Abstract

We study a duality analysis in conjunction with the star-triangle transformation for symmetric-group permutation models on the triangular and honeycomb lattices. The calculation is motivated by the permutation-model description of random tensor networks and by earlier duality analyses of replicated spin glasses. The essential point is that the finite-basis unit is not a bare bond but a star-triangle block. Our analysis estimates the critical bond dimension for the honeycomb lattice to be 2.634929344884, and the associated single-bond duality relation yields the triangular-lattice estimate 1.475661534848.
